What is cold-blooded and warm blooded What is the difference?

Warm blooded animals (homeotherms) maintain a consistent body temperature. Cold blooded animals (poikilotherms) will have body temperatures that vary with the temperature of their environment.

Mammals (including humans) and birds are warm-blooded animals. Reptiles and fish are cold-blooded animals.
